private void button1_Click(object sender, RoutedEventArgs e) { Routine newRoutine = new Routine(); Controller.Routines.Add(newRoutine); RoutineBuilder builder = new RoutineBuilder(newRoutine); builder.Show(); //BADDDDD WindowManager.CurrentViews[typeof(RoutineBuilder)] = builder; }